The disclosure relates to the field of rocket case body capturing and recycling, in particular to a Z-shaped layout fixed-length double-rope grouped closed force system capturing and recycling net system.
The rocket case body capturing and recycling technology refers to a technology for recycling and reusing rockets after launching. The launching cost of a disposable carrier rocket is very high. The high launching cost is an important factor for restricting the development of the aerospace industry. The use of the rocket case body recycling technology can reduce the launching cost. The cost of each launching is as high as 60 million dollars. If a rocket case body is successfully recycled, it is possible to reduce the cost to less than 10 million dollars for one launching, and the effect is significant.
A rocket case body recycling method mainly includes a parachute recycling method and a rocket gliding recycling method. The parachute recycling method is to unfold a parachute after a rocket enters the atmosphere, decelerate the rocket by resistance, and then lands the rocket vertically to the ground. This method is suitable for smaller rockets and satellites. The rocket gliding recycling method means that the rocket glides in the atmosphere by means of wings to perform a certain degree of deceleration and control, and then lands the rocket vertically by a propeller. This recycling method is relatively cumbersome in process. a capturing and intercepting assembly, where the capturing and intercepting assembly includes a rope group a1, a rope group b2, a rope group c3 and a rope group d4, the rope group a1, the rope group b2, the rope group c3 and the rope group d4 are each wound with two movable wheel groups 5 oppositely arranged, the rope group a1 between the movable wheel groups 5 is an intercepting section a6, the rope group b2 between the two movable wheel groups 5 is an intercepting section b7, the rope group c3 between the two movable wheel groups 5 is an intercepting section c8, the rope group d4 between the two movable wheel groups 5 is an intercepting section d9, the intercepting section a6 and the intercepting section b7 are arranged in parallel, the intercepting section c8 and the intercepting section d9 are arranged in parallel, and the intercepting section a6 and the intercepting section c8 are arranged perpendicularly; and
a supporting assembly, where the supporting assembly includes four stand columns 10 fixedly connected to a base 11, a guide rail 12 is fixedly connected between the two adjacent stand columns 10, the movable wheel groups 5 are slidingly connected to the guide rail 12, a traction device 15 is drivingly connected to the movable wheel groups 5, a plurality of fixed wheels 13 are arranged on the stand column 10, the rope group a1, the rope group b2, the rope group c3 and the rope group d4 are each wound around the different fixed wheels 13, and ends of the rope group a1, the rope group b2, the rope group c3 and the rope group d4 are each connected to the four stand columns 10.
The present device is arranged on the base. The four stand columns 10 are used to support the present device. The rope group a1, the rope group b2, the rope group c3 and the rope group d4 are used to intercept a rocket case body. The intercepting section a6 and the intercepting section b7 are arranged in parallel, the intercepting section c8 and the intercepting section d9 are arranged in parallel, and the intercepting section a6 and the intercepting section c8 are arranged perpendicularly, so that the intercepting section a6, the intercepting section b7, the intercepting section c8 and the intercepting section d9 form a #-shaped structure, the rocket case body falls into the middle of the #-shaped structure, and the two movable wheel groups 5 on the rope group a1 are respectively arranged on the two opposite guide rails 12. During the recycling of the rocket case body, it is necessary to continuously adjust the movable wheel groups 5. The traction device 15 can make the movable wheel groups 5 move on the guide rails 12. Each movable wheel group 5 can be provided with two traction devices 15 to facilitate the movement of the movable wheel groups 5. The two movable wheel groups 5 on the rope group b2, the rope group c3 and the rope group d4 are arranged in the same way as the rope group a1. The multiple fixed wheels 13 are used to guide the directions of the rope group a1, the rope group b2, the rope group c3 and the rope group d4, so that the rope group a1, the rope group b2, the rope group c3 and the rope group d4 enter the insides of the stand columns 10 to facilitate the connection of two ends of the rope group a1, the rope group b2, the rope group c3 and the rope group d4 to other devices. The working principle of the present device is that in the present device, the lengths of the intercepting cables 14 are adjusted by the rope retracting and releasing mechanisms 16. The tensioning mechanisms 17 tension the intercepting cables 14. The intercepting section a6, the intercepting section b7, the intercepting section c8 and the intercepting section d9 form a #-shaped structure to intercept the rocket case body. When the rocket case body is about to fall down, the movable wheel group 5 can be moved by the traction devices to move the intercepting section a6, the intercepting section b7, the intercepting section c8 and the intercepting section d9, and adjust the interception position. In each rope group, there is an intercepting cable 14 on each movable wheel group 5. The intercepting cable 14 on each movable wheel group 5 pulls the movable wheel group 5 to both sides, so that the movable wheel group 5 is in a balanced state. When the traction device 15 pulls the movable wheel group 5 to move, less force can be used, thereby reducing the force of the traction devices 15.
The movable group 5 is in a self-balancing state. The self-balancing movable wheel group 5 is composed of two movable wheels and connecting seats thereof. The force of the intercepting cable 14 can be converted into the internal force of the system to form a closed force system to prevent the traction cable on the traction device 15 from being affected by the same tension as the intercepting cable 14. At the same time, the initial tension of the intercepting cable 14 can be prevented from acting on the traction cable system. Since the intercepting cables 14 are in a symmetrical Z-shaped layout, the two intercepting cables 14 in each movable wheel group 5 form an intersection near the mid-span position. This intersection will produce a certain friction force. After experiments, it has been verified that the friction force is significantly less than the tension. In this way, the present device forms a set of closed force system recycling systems, which cancels the action force of the tensioning system, decreases the moving mass, decreases the length of the intercepting cable 14, and decreases the traction power to the maximum extent.

The two ropes of the rope group a are both in a Z shape. When the two movable wheel groups on the rope group a move in the same direction at the same time, the two ropes only enter the intercepting section a from the movable wheel on one side, move the intercepting section a from the movable wheel out on the other side at the same length. The length of the intercepting section a is unchanged. In the same way, when the two movable wheels on the rope group b, the rope group c and the rope group d move at the same time, the lengths of the intercepting section b, the intercepting section c and the intercepting section d are also unchanged. When moving, the intercepting section a is parallel to the intercepting section b, and the intercepting section c is parallel to the intercepting section d. It is more reliable when intercepting the rocket case body, and during the movement of all intercepting sections, the two ends of the rope and the tensioning mechanisms thereof do not need to move.
